The author argues that every AI system is a division of labor involving three parts: the parametric model (good at generalization, poor at arithmetic and forgetting), software tools (augmenting model weaknesses), and the human (defining workflows and responsibility). The key to system design is finding the right boundaries and interfaces between them.
